Structure and Content of the Theory Exam


The Swedish driving theory exam includes 65 questions, from which 60 are scored and 5 are experimental questions used for future test advancement. Candidates need to accomplish a minimum score of 52 correct responses out of the 60 scored concerns to pass, which represents around 87% accuracy. The exam covers multiple classifications of knowledge, each screening different elements of accountable driving.

The question formats differ in between multiple-choice and direct response concerns, with some products requiring candidates to determine components within traffic images or scenarios. The visual parts present prospects with pictures or videos depicting different traffic circumstances, requiring them to determine proper actions, potential dangers, or guideline infractions. This multimedia approach ensures that theoretical understanding equates to real-world recognition and appropriate reactions.

Core Topics Covered in the Curriculum


The Swedish driving theory includes a number of interconnected subject locations that together develop a comprehensive understanding of safe driving. Traffic regulations form the foundation, covering whatever from right-of-way guidelines to speed limits and correct signaling. Prospects must understand not only these regulations but likewise the reasoning behind them, as this much deeper understanding supports better decision-making in intricate circumstances.

Threat understanding represents another important element of the theory examination. Candidates learn to determine potential threats before they materialize into actual dangers. This proactive method to safety distinguishes the Swedish system from more procedural-focused licensing systems elsewhere. Understanding how climate condition affect braking distances, how tiredness impairs response times, and how to change driving behavior for various road surface areas prepares chauffeurs for the diverse conditions they will come across.

Environmental considerations have actually significantly entered into the theoretical curriculum, reflecting Sweden's wider dedication to sustainability. Drivers learn about the environmental impact of their options, including how driving behavior impacts fuel consumption and emissions. This ecological awareness helps develop more responsible chauffeurs who comprehend their contribution to cumulative environmental outcomes.

Preparation Strategies and Resources


Success on the Swedish driving theory examination needs organized preparation and access to quality study products. The main Swedish Transport Administration, referred to as Transportstyrelsen, provides practice tests through their website and mobile applications. These official resources offer the most precise representation of real exam material and format, making them important tools for severe prospects.

Respectable driving schools throughout Sweden offer theory courses that combine class guideline with practice testing. Expert instructors can explain complex concepts, address private misunderstandings, and provide context that helps product stick in memory. Numerous schools utilize interactive mentor techniques that engage several learning methods, improving retention and understanding.

Developing a research study schedule that allocates devoted time for theory preparation yields better results than cramming sessions. The extensive nature of the material rewards consistent, dispersed practice over intensive however infrequent research study durations. Prospects who engage with the material frequently, evaluating both familiar and tough topics, develop more robust knowledge structures that support reputable recall during the examination.

Typical Challenges and How to Overcome Them


Numerous prospects battle with the threat perception components, which need fast and precise assessment of developing dangerous scenarios. The secret to enhancement depends on comprehensive practice with varied circumstances, training the eye to recognize subtle hints that indicate possible issues. Comprehending that threats can emerge from several sources— other vehicles, pedestrians, roadway conditions, and weather— assists prospects establish more comprehensive threat awareness.

Language barriers present obstacles for some candidates, particularly brand-new residents who may be not familiar with driving terms in Swedish. Luckily, the theory exam is readily available in fifteen various languages, allowing prospects to finish the evaluation in their native tongue. However, candidates should think about that practical driving guideline takes place mainly in Swedish, so some familiarity with driving-related vocabulary shows useful for the subsequent useful training.

The experimental questions consisted of in each test can unsettle some candidates who encounter unknown material. Understanding that these questions do not affect scoring helps prospects maintain composure when facing novel products. Remaining focused on showing understanding through familiar questions prevents stress and anxiety about speculative products from weakening overall performance.

The Path to Practical Driving


Passing the theory test represents a considerable turning point but not the last location in getting a Swedish motorist's license. The theory certificate remains legitimate for two years, throughout which prospects must finish their required useful training and road test. This validity duration motivates candidates to advance effectively through the remaining licensing requirements while ensuring their theoretical knowledge remains existing.

The useful driving test evaluates Candidates' capability to use their theoretical knowledge in real traffic conditions. Inspectors examine not just technical car control but also decision-making, anticipation of threats, and adherence to the safety concepts studied in the theory portion. Prospects who truly internalized their theoretical training usually demonstrate more positive and suitable actions during the practical evaluation.

Frequently Asked Questions


For how long does it take to prepare for the Swedish driving theory examination?

Preparation time varies considerably based upon specific situations, including previous driving experience, language familiarity, and readily available research study time. The majority of candidates require in between 2 and four months of constant study to feel thoroughly prepared. First-time drivers usually require more preparation than those with previous driving experience from other nations.

Can I take the theory examination in English or my native language?

Yes, the Swedish driving theory exam is offered in Swedish plus fourteen other languages, consisting of English, Arabic, Persian, Somali, and numerous European languages. However, candidates should keep in mind that the practical driving lessons and roadway test are conducted in Swedish, so developing some Swedish vocabulary related to driving proves beneficial.

The number of times can I attempt the theory examination if I stop working?

There is no limitation on the variety of attempts at the theory test. Candidates should pay the assessment fee for each attempt, and a waiting period of normally one week applies in between efforts. However, repeated failures suggest a need for extra preparation, and candidates must think about seeking advice from driving trainers to recognize and attend to knowledge gaps.

Is the Swedish driving theory exam hard for citizens from other nations?

Difficulty depends mainly on the candidate's existing driving understanding and familiarity with Swedish traffic regulations. Those from nations with comparable traffic guidelines may discover the shift manageable, while candidates from substantially various driving cultures might require more extensive preparation. The exam's focus on comprehending principles instead of mere memorization advantages candidates who take time to truly comprehend the thinking behind Swedish traffic guidelines.

Do I need to finish the theory test before starting useful driving lessons?

Swedish guidelines need prospects to pass the theory exam before scheduling their practical driving test, however prospects may start practical training before passing the theory assessment. Lots of driving schools encourage candidates to study theory simultaneously with useful lessons, as the experiential knowing from behind-the-wheel practice can reinforce theoretical understanding.
